Short summary

We generated five new and compiled previously published Holocene temperature timeseries from southwestern Greenland. We found temperature maxima between 7500 and 5000 years ago, with temperatures approx. 2–5 °C higher than 1994–2024. Afterward, temperatures gradually cooled towards the present, following maximum summer insolation. Local variations in the magnitude and timing of the thermal maximum are related to topography and proximity to the ice sheet and the ocean.
